Durability
Let's start with the most obvious one: durability. Stainless steel is known for its toughness, and when it comes to conveyor mesh belts, this quality shines. It can withstand a wide range of environmental conditions. Whether it's hot, cold, wet, or dry, a stainless-steel conveyor mesh belt can handle it. For example, in food processing plants, where belts are constantly exposed to water and cleaning agents, stainless steel doesn't rust or corrode easily. This means a longer lifespan for the belt, which saves you money in the long run. You don't have to keep replacing belts every few months because of wear and tear.
Another aspect of its durability is its resistance to mechanical stress. These belts can handle heavy loads without stretching or breaking. In industries like mining or manufacturing, where large and heavy items need to be transported, a stainless-steel conveyor mesh belt can take the weight and keep moving. Hygiene
Hygiene is a big deal, especially in industries like food, pharmaceuticals, and electronics. Stainless-steel conveyor mesh belts are easy to clean and sanitize. The smooth surface of the stainless steel doesn't allow dirt, bacteria, or other contaminants to stick to it easily. You can simply hose it down or use cleaning agents to keep it spotless. In the food industry, this is crucial to meet strict health and safety standards. Imagine a bakery where bread is being transported on a conveyor belt. If the belt isn't clean, it could contaminate the bread, leading to health risks and potential legal issues. With a stainless-steel conveyor mesh belt, you can rest assured that your products are being transported in a clean and hygienic environment.
Versatility
One of the best things about stainless-steel conveyor mesh belts is their versatility. They can be used in a wide variety of industries and applications. In the food industry, they're used for baking, cooling, freezing, and sorting. For instance, in a pizza factory, the conveyor belt can carry the pizzas through the oven for baking and then to the cooling area. In the electronics industry, these belts are used for assembling and testing electronic components. They can handle delicate parts without causing any damage.


There are also different types of stainless-steel conveyor mesh belts available to suit different needs. The Net Conveyor Belt is great for applications where you need good air circulation, such as in drying processes. The Stainless Steel Mesh Belt is a general-purpose belt that can be used in many situations. And the Ladder Mesh Belt is ideal for conveying heavy or irregularly shaped objects.
High-Temperature Resistance
In some industries, high temperatures are a part of the process. Stainless-steel conveyor mesh belts are up to the challenge. They can withstand high temperatures without losing their strength or shape. In glass manufacturing, for example, the belts need to carry hot glass products from one stage to another. The high-temperature resistance of stainless steel ensures that the belt doesn't warp or break under the intense heat. This allows for a smooth and continuous production process.
Low Maintenance
As a business owner, you don't want to spend a lot of time and money on maintenance. Stainless-steel conveyor mesh belts are relatively low-maintenance. They don't require frequent lubrication like some other types of belts. And because they're durable and resistant to wear and tear, you don't have to worry about replacing parts often.
